Drobotics is committed to relentlessly innovating how drones execute flight missions. Our software is designed from the ground up to leverage AI and mimic human recognition, classification, and decision making processes – enabling next generation adaptive flight automation – and safe integration of drones with the national airspace.
We created a deep learning neural network that establishes a communications link between the drone and external databases that contain training tools.
Once the drone is powered on, our software integrates with the LAANC/UTM systems to obtain airspace authorizations.
When a notice to proceed is received from LAANC/UTM, our software guides the drone to make a preliminary scan of the asset and computes the optimal flight path for the inspection.
During the inspection, our software handles any LAANC/UTM authorizations that may be required if adjustments to the flight path are needed, or new areas of interest are classified.
Once the drone has completed the inspection, the software guides the drone to the next asset location and handles all LAANC/UTM authorization requirements along the flight path.
